With 9 gold medals, 6 silver, and 5 bronze medals, India is leading the ISSF World Cup 2021 table. Today was the 7th day of the tournament where shooters from more than 50 nations are competing in different categories. Indian won one more gold taking the total score to 21 medals.

The first round of the day i.e final 50m Rifle was, however, postponed due to an internal dispute between the shooters of India and Hungary. In the second two rounds which were the team events, Indian shooters bagged silver and gold. Here are the updates.

After the defeat, Poland slipped to the fourth spot in the chart. Chink Yadav who hails from Madhya Pradesh has won gold in the individual round whereas the Manu and Rahi finished with silvers.

However, in the 50m rifle event Indian women team failed to bring gold for the country after getting defeated by 4 points from Poland. Gayathri Nithyanandam, Anjum Moudgil, and Shreya Saksena were competing against Poland’s women shooting team in the 50m rifle event.
